Kate Azarova is a researcher in SFOC’s Methane Team, specializing in methane emissions reduction and regulatory frameworks across Korea and Asia, with a focus on China and Japan. She conducts research and facilitates international collaboration to advance policies and strategies for methane mitigation. Kate holds a Ph.D. in International Business from Ewha Womans University, where her research focused on the transition from fossil fuels to green energy, renewable energy investments, and sustainability reporting. She has a diverse background in finance, technology, and project management, with experience in consulting, leading cross-functional teams, and driving global CSR and green finance initiatives.
